The landscape of Electronic Health Record (EHR) Incentive Programs has changed again. The new Quality Payment Program introduced by CMS provides options designed to make it easier for small practices to report on performance and qualify for incentives.

Physicians in small practices who report their performance can do just as well as mid-sized or larger practices. CMS expects the number and percentage of small practices participating in the Quality Payment Program to increase and exceed participation in legacy programs (for example, PQRS) because of the reduced reporting burden, increasing the usability of technology, and stepped-up technical assistance. There are some other flexibilities in the final rule to help small practices, including exemptions for low-volume practices, allowances for patient-centered medical homes, and increased technical assistance.
